Trams in Schwerin

The Schwerin tramway network (German: Straßenbahnnetz Schwerin) is a network of tramways forming the key feature of the public transport system in Schwerin, the capital city of the federal state of Mecklenburg-Vorpommern, Germany.

Opened on 1 December 1908, the electrically powered network is currently operated by Nahverkehr Schwerin GmbH, and has four lines.
